The School of Electrical Engineering and Computer Science (EECS) was created in the spring of 2015 to allow greater access to courses offered by the Departments of Electrical Engineering and Computer Science and Engineering. The partnership between the departments allows EECS undergraduate and graduate students to easily engage in exciting collaborative research fields.

We offer undergraduate degrees in computer science, computer engineering, data sciences, and electrical engineering, and graduate degrees in computer science and engineering and in electrical engineering. EECS focuses on the convergence of technologies and disciplines to meet today’s industrial demands.
